Mistral AI Launches Robot Model for Single-Camera Navigation
Mistral AI has unveiled "RoboStral", its first robot model capable of navigating unfamiliar environments using data solely from a single camera.

Vad har hänt
Mistral AI has formally introduced "RoboStral", a new robotics model designed to facilitate navigation in complex environments. The model is trained to interpret video and images from a single camera to achieve this. "RoboStral" marks Mistral AI's first specific venture into robotics based on visual inputs.

Varför det spelar roll
The development of "RoboStral" is significant as it addresses a central challenge in robotics: enabling robust navigation with minimal sensor infrastructure. By relying solely on one camera, hardware costs and complexity can be significantly reduced. This could accelerate the integration of autonomous navigation across numerous robotics applications by making the technology more accessible and scalable.
